For this we need to store the linkage of the “original” method implementation in the vtable.
Otherwise DeadFunctionElimination thinks that the method implementation is not public but private (which is the linkage of the thunk).

The big part of this change is to extend SILVTable to store the linkage (+ serialization, printing, etc.).
